What are the key features of CD74HC4016E?
- Quad SPST (Single-Pole Single-Throw) analog switch with four independent 1:1 channels for versatile signal routing
- 200MHz analog bandwidth with up to 6V input voltage range, supporting both digital and analog signal switching applications
- 14-Pin DIP package with RoHS-compliant (e4) lead-free construction for through-hole assembly and easy prototyping
What is CD74HC4016E used for?
The CD74HC4016E is widely used for analog signal multiplexing and routing in audio systems, data acquisition equipment, and communication interfaces where multiple signal paths need to be independently controlled. Its four independent SPST channels and 200MHz bandwidth make it suitable for RF signal switching, instrumentation front-ends, and analog bus management in mixed-signal designs. The through-hole DIP package provides convenience for breadboard prototyping, development boards, and legacy system maintenance.
What are the specifications of CD74HC4016E?
| Pbfree Code | Yes |
| YTEOL | 3.9 |
| Additional Feature | Configuration : 1:1 SPST |
| Analog IC - Other Type | SPST |
| Bandwidth-Nom | 200MHz |
| Input Voltage-Max | 6V |
| JESD-30 Code | R-PDIP-T14 |
| JESD-609 Code | e4 |
| Normal Position | NO |
| Number of Channels | 4 |
| Number of Functions | 4 |
| Off-state Isolation-Nom | 62dB |
| On-state Resistance Match-Nom | 10Ω |
| On-state Resistance-Max (Ron) | 320Ω |
| Output | SEPARATE OUTPUT |
| Package Body Material | PLASTIC/EPOXY |
| Package Equivalence Code | DIP14,.3 |
| Package Shape | RECTANGULAR |
| Package Style | IN-LINE |
| Qualification Status | Not Qualified |
| Signal Current-Max | 0.025A |
| Supply Current-Max (Isup) | 0.32mA |
| Supply Voltage-Max (Vsup) | 10V |
| Supply Voltage-Min (Vsup) | 2V |
| Supply Voltage-Nom (Vsup) | 4.5V |
| Surface Mount | NO |
| Switch-off Time-Max | 29ns |
| Switch-on Time-Max | 38ns |
| Switching | BREAK-BEFORE-MAKE |
| Technology | CMOS |
| Temperature Grade | MILITARY |
| Terminal Finish | Nickel/Palladium/Gold (Ni/Pd/Au) |
| Terminal Form | THROUGH-HOLE |
| Terminal Pitch | 2.54mm |
| Terminal Position | DUAL |
| Package | Dual-In-Line Packages |

Frequently Asked Questions
How many channels does the CD74HC4016E have?
The CD74HC4016E features four independent SPST (Single-Pole Single-Throw) analog switch channels configured as 1:1 switches, allowing each channel to independently connect or disconnect its input and output for flexible signal routing in analog and mixed-signal systems.
What is the bandwidth of the CD74HC4016E?
The CD74HC4016E has a nominal bandwidth of 200MHz, making it suitable for switching both low-frequency analog signals and high-frequency applications such as RF and video signal routing up to the UHF frequency range.
What package does the CD74HC4016E come in?
The CD74HC4016E is housed in a 14-Pin DIP (Dual In-Line Package, JESD-30 code R-PDIP-T14), a through-hole package widely used in prototyping, educational electronics, and legacy designs requiring through-hole PCB assembly.
What is the maximum input voltage for the CD74HC4016E?
The CD74HC4016E supports a maximum input voltage of 6V, with RoHS-compliant and lead-free construction (JESD-609 e4), making it suitable for 3.3V and 5V logic-controlled analog switching in consumer, industrial, and instrumentation applications.
